- What rebates and programs do you help with?
- Mass Save (up to $8,500 standard, $10,000 in CMLP/WMLP territory), federal HEAR (up to $8,000 for qualifying heat pumps), Mass HEAT Loan (0% APR up to $50,000), weatherization tracks, ConnectedSolutions battery dispatch, and similar utility-run programs in other regions. The federal 25D residential solar credit expired Dec 31, 2025; state and utility incentives remain.
- What about my battery?
- If a battery is installed on the owner’s side and you’re in Eversource territory, ConnectedSolutions can pay up to $4,388/yr from a Powerwall 3 at 2026 rates. We handle eligibility and enrollment. [How we measure →]
